The July 2005 newsletter of the Sandia Heights Homeowners Association covers the outcomes of the annual meeting held on June 4. Four new directors were welcomed to the Board of Directors, and changes to the by-laws were approved. Various committees provided summaries of their activities throughout the year, highlighting the need for more volunteers in areas such as the Covenants Support Committee, Architectural Control Committee, Traffic and Safety Committee, and Parks and New Development Committee. Concerns regarding traffic-calming measures, safety on the streets, and potential commercial developments were raised during a Town Hall meeting, emphasizing the importance of community input for setting priorities. The newsletter also announced upcoming community events like the Sandia Heights Community Picnic and Jazz Under the Stars.
An event at the Four Seasons Pool and Tennis Club off Tramway is highlighted, with games and activities for all ages planned, including access to the pool and tennis courts. The Membership Committee will offer complimentary shuttle service, and the helicopter rescue crew will be present with a helicopter for demonstration and questions.
